AI For CAD Detection
Webinar Overview
Untapping the full potential of opportunistic detection of subclinical atherosclerotic cardiovascular disease using artificial intelligence (AI).
Subclinical atherosclerotic cardiovascular disease (ASCVD) often remains undetected until it manifests as acute cardiovascular events. Advancements in AI have enabled the opportunistic detection of ASCVD using imaging modalities performed for other clinical indications, such as non-electrocardiogram (ECG) gated chest computed tomography (CT). This session, hosted by ACC's Health Care Innovation Member Section, will explore the integration of AI algorithms in analyzing routine imaging studies to identify incidental findings indicative of ASCVD, thereby facilitating early intervention and improved patient outcomes.
Key Objectives/Learning Outcomes:
- Understand the role of AI in analyzing non-ECG gated chest CT scans for the opportunistic detection of coronary artery calcium and its clinical implications.
- Explore the application of AI-enhanced imaging technologies in identifying subclinical ASCVD during routine non-cardiac imaging procedures.
- Discuss the challenges and opportunities associated with integrating AI-based opportunistic screening into clinical workflows.
- Evaluate the impact of early detection of subclinical ASCVD on patient management and outcomes.
